Gwyneth Paltrow Once Threw a Dinner Party Where Everyone Barfed

Gwyneth Paltrow Once Threw a Dinner Party Where Everyone Barfed

خليجية

Yeah, yeah — we’re aware not Everyone is a fan of the perfectly polished Paltrow.
And that the mere thought of her is enough to make some of you retch.

But Gwyneth herself is spilling the beans on an early ****ing mishap that literally left her dining guests losing their lunch. She was only 18 at the time, so we’ll give her a break.
“I went to the store and bought an eggplant and a jar of tomato sauce and some really rubbery mozzarella cheese, “she told Rachael Ray. “I didn’t know that when you **** eggplant, you first have to sweat it to get all the bitter juice out, and I didn’t realize that you also have to bread eggplant parmesan and fry it before. So I put slices of raw eggplant with jarred tomato sauce and mozzarella. And Everyone Threw up.”

Her ****ing has since improved, and she’s even announced she’s working on a third ****book that will focus on “clean comfort food” for the whole family:

I just run out of ideas for the kids and family. … I think I might do appetizers for a Party section because that’s always a tough one. It’s like you’re having a party, and you don’t want to be in the kitchen. Kind of make-ahead trays and stuff you can stick in the oven. I would love easy Party food and kid-family food, and that’s Where I am right now.

For those who can’t get to L.A., they can follow Gwyneth’s Goop plan.
The website states that it is a ‘simple but tough’ detox. Basically, you have avoid all your favourite foods and drinks.
It explains: ‘Just say no to: alcohol, caffeine, added sugar, gluten, dairy, soy, corn, and nightshades (white, blue, red, and yellow potatoes, tomatoes, eggplant).’ Easy!
Other tips for an effective detox include drinking plenty of water (‘hot water in the morning is key’) and ‘getting to the spa for a handful of treatments: Anything that gets the lymphatic system moving is clutch, and IR saunas are particularly great (and effective) as sweat is one of our ****’s most effective means for flushing toxins.’
It adds: ‘Think about kicking the week off with a colonic – they definitely get things going.’

Gwyneth Paltrow Talks Aging: "I’d Rather Die Than Study My Face"

Gwyneth Paltrow Talks Aging: "I’d Rather Die Than Study My Face"

She’s of the generation of actresses who have defied many of the barriers women face in Hollywood.
And at 42 years of age Gwyneth Paltrow is enjoying a career that is only continuing to blossom.
The actress recently opened up about the ageing process with Stylist.co.uk where she admitted she’d ‘rather die’ Than Study her face in the mirror.

‘I’m not the type to look in the mirror and Study my looks,’ Paltrow explained.
Adding: ‘God no! I’d Rather die Than be studying my face like that!’
And when it comes to her morning beauty routine, she likes to keep it simple.
